CHILLAGOE

OF MELBOURNE, A. LAMONT, MASTER, BURTHEN 1490/956 TONS
FROM THE PORT OF GEELONG TO SYDNEY, NEW SOUTH WALES, 10TH JANUARY 1919

Surname Given name Station Age Of what Nation Status Comments
LAMONT A MASTER 37 SCOTLAND CREW  
MCADIE A MATE 32 SCOTLAND CREW  
PEACOCK E 2ND MATE 24 LIVERPOOL CREW  
GORDON G. C. 3RD OFFICER 48 SCOTLAND CREW  
BANNER N BOATSWAIN 45 GREECE CREW or BANNA
MATT J A. B. 44 RUSSIA CREW  
WESTILA T A. B. 23 FINLAND CREW  
STEPHENSON A A. B. 22 SUNDERLAND CREW  
BAXTER J A. B. 27 LONDON CREW  
STAVIO D A. B. 40 GREECE CREW  
RILEY J O. S. 21 TASMANIA CREW  
GORDON G CHIEF ENGINEER 34 HOBART CREW  
DUNNE H 2ND ENGINEER 27 BUNDABERG CREW  
SHALE A 3RD ENGINEER 24 BRISBANE CREW  
ANGELO A DONKEYMAN 54 GREECE CREW  
ALEXANDER M FIREMAN 31 GREECE CREW  
DALE J FIREMAN 50 LANCASHIRE CREW  
MITCHINSON T FIREMAN 42 LIVERPOOL CREW  
QUINN C FIREMAN 22 MELBOURNE CREW  
PAGE A FIREMAN 32 SOUTH AUSTRALIA CREW  
MCGUIRK H FIREMAN 45 SOUTH SHIELDS CREW  
LATTER G CHIEF STEWARD 41 ESSEX CREW  
MOWX A ASST. STEWARD 19 LONDON CREW  
MASSEY D CHIEF COOK 56 LONDON CREW  
MASSEY H ASST. COOK 22 MELBOURNE CREW  

 

Source: State Records Authority of New South Wales: Shipping Master's Office; Passengers Arriving 1855 - 1922; NRS13278, [X435] reel 2104, 2105.   Transcribed by Lyn & Maurie.
